An open API service indexing awesome lists of open source software.

https://github.com/PierrunoYT/awesome-ai-dev-tools

A curated list of powerful and innovative AI-powered development tools, including code editors, plugins, and productivity enhancers.
https://github.com/PierrunoYT/awesome-ai-dev-tools

List: awesome-ai-dev-tools

Last synced: 4 months ago
JSON representation

A curated list of powerful and innovative AI-powered development tools, including code editors, plugins, and productivity enhancers.

Awesome Lists containing this project

README

        

# Awesome AI Dev Tools

A curated list of powerful and innovative AI-powered development tools, including code editors, plugins, and productivity enhancers.

## Table of Contents
- [Development Environments](#development-environments)
- [AI-Powered IDEs](#ai-powered-ides)
- [Code Editors](#code-editors)
- [Web-Based Environments](#web-based-environments)
- [AI Coding Assistants](#ai-coding-assistants)
- [General Purpose Assistants](#general-purpose-assistants)
- [Specialized Assistants](#specialized-assistants)
- [IDE Extensions](#ide-extensions)
- [Code Generation & Analysis](#code-generation--analysis)
- [Code Review Tools](#code-review-tools)
- [Pull Request Automation](#pull-request-automation)
- [Testing Tools](#testing-tools)
- [Documentation Generation](#documentation-generation)
- [Application Development](#application-development)
- [App Generators](#app-generators)
- [UI/UX Tools](#uiux-tools)
- [Database Tools](#database-tools)
- [Developer Productivity](#developer-productivity)
- [Git Tools](#git-tools)
- [Command Line Tools](#command-line-tools)
- [Search Tools](#search-tools)
- [Productivity Tools](#productivity-tools)
- [AI Agents & Platforms](#ai-agents--platforms)
- [Development Agents](#development-agents)
- [Agent Platforms](#agent-platforms)
- [OpenAI Plugins](#openai-plugins)

## Development Environments

### AI-Powered IDEs
- [CodeStory](https://codestory.ai/) - IDE with chat, explanations, auto-generated commits and PR summaries.
- [Copilot Workspace](https://githubnext.com/projects/copilot-workspace) - Task-oriented development environment with GPT-4, multi-file coordination, and integrated testing capabilities.
- [Cursor](https://www.cursor.so/) - IDE with chat, edit, generate and debug features. Uses OpenAI.
- [MarsCode](https://www.marscode.com/) - Cloud-based IDE with AI assistant, supporting 100+ languages and intelligent code completion.
- [Mutable](https://mutable.ai/) - AI-powered platform for enhancing software engineer productivity.
- [Project IDX](https://idx.dev) - Google's cloud-based IDE with Gemini AI integration, built on VS Code core with multi-framework and multiplatform support.
- [PyCharm](https://www.jetbrains.com/pycharm/) - Popular IDE for Python with intelligent code assistance.
- [Replit](https://replit.com/) - Web-based IDE with cloud environments, code completion, chat, and deployments.
- [Trae](https://www.trae.ai/) - ByteDance's AI-powered IDE with GPT-4 and Claude integration, featuring Builder and Chat modes.
- [Windsurf AI](https://codeium.com/windsurf) - Advanced IDE by Codeium with Cascade technology for deep context awareness, multi-file editing, and enterprise-ready AI features.

### Code Editors
- [Aide Dev](https://aide.dev) - Open-source AI-native code editor with local-first operation, multi-file context understanding, and integrated AI assistance.
- [Melty](https://melty.sh/) - Open source VS Code fork with chat, change previews, and AI commits.
- [PearAI](https://trypear.ai/) - Open source VS Code fork with chat and inline code generation.
- [UI Pilot](https://ui-pilot.com/) - Chat-based AI code editor for Material UI forms using GPT-4.
- [Zed](https://zed.dev) - High-performance code editor with Claude 3.5 Sonnet integration, real-time streaming diffs, and multi-provider AI assistance.
- [Void](https://voideditor.com/) - Open-source AI-powered code editor with local model hosting support.

### Web-Based Environments
- [Adrenaline](https://useadrenaline.com/) - AI-powered chatbot for codebase questions.
- [bolt.new](https://bolt.new) - Browser-based platform for creating full-stack web applications through natural language using WebContainers technology.
- [bolt.diy](https://github.com/stackblitz-labs/bolt.diy) - Open-source, self-hosted version of bolt.new with multi-provider LLM support and integrated development environment.
- [GitHub Spark](https://githubnext.com/projects/github-spark/) - Platform for creating micro applications through natural language with instant deployment and AI integration.
- [Lovable.dev](https://lovable.dev) - AI-powered platform for generating full-stack web apps with shadcn/ui components and Supabase integration.
- [Magnet](https://www.magnet.run/) - Web-based chatbot for repositories and issues.
- [Onboard](https://www.getonboardai.com) - AI chat for public and private codebases.
- [Replit Ghostwriter Chat](https://replit.com/site/ghostwriter) - AI assistant in Replit with various features.
- [Sourcegraph Cody](https://about.sourcegraph.com/cody) - AI assistant with multiple features and integrations.
- [Unblocked](https://getunblocked.com/) - AI-powered code context and chat assistant.

## AI Coding Assistants

### General Purpose Assistants
- [AskCodi](https://www.askcodi.com/) - AI-powered coding assistance with IDE integration.
- [Bito AI](https://bito.ai/) - Advanced AI tool for enhancing developer productivity.
- [Codeium](https://codeium.com/) - Fast, context-aware code autocomplete with chat for 70+ languages.
- [Cody](https://sourcegraph.com/cody) - AI coding assistant by Sourcegraph.
- [Continue](https://www.continue.dev/) - AI-powered code assistant with customization features.
- [Exponent](https://www.exponent.run/) - AI pair programming platform with filesystem integration, advanced models, and specialized task support.
- [GitHub Copilot](https://github.com/features/copilot) - AI-powered code suggestions for 70+ languages.
- [aiXcoder](https://www.aixcoder.com/en/#/) - Intelligent Programming Assistant with predictive coding.
- [Amazon Q Developer](https://aws.amazon.com/q/) - AI coding assistant for AWS technologies.
- [Tabnine](https://www.tabnine.com/) - AI code assistant with privacy focus and wide language support.
- [Kodezi](https://kodezi.com/) - Comprehensive AI-powered developer tool.
- [OpenAI Codex](https://platform.openai.com/docs/guides/code/) - AI system translating natural language to code.
- [Amazon CodeWhisperer](https://aws.amazon.com/codewhisperer/) - ML-powered coding companion for various IDEs and CLIs.

### Specialized Assistants
- [Plandex](https://plandex.ai/) - Open-source, terminal-based AI coding engine for complex projects.
- [Aider](https://aider.chat/) - Open-source AI pair programming tool with Git integration.
- [OpenHands](https://github.com/All-Hands-AI/OpenHands) - Open-source AI dev assistant with multi-language support.
- [API Copilot](https://apicopilot.dev/) - Assistant for backend API development.
- [CodeWP](https://codewp.ai/) - AI tools for WordPress developers.
- [Gur.ai](https://www.gru.ai/) - AI developer for various coding tasks.

### IDE Extensions
- [GitHub Copilot X](https://github.com/features/preview/copilot-x) - VS Code extension with advanced features.
- [Refact AI](https://refact.ai/) - Open source assistant for VS Code and JetBrains.
- [Continue](https://continue.dev/) - VS Code extension with advanced coding features.
- [Blackbox AI](https://www.useblackbox.io/) - VS Code extension with autocomplete and chat.
- [CodeGeeX](https://codegeex.cn/) - Open source assistant for multiple editors.
- [Kodu](https://github.com/kodu-ai) - Privacy-focused VS Code extension with local operation and multi-language support.
- [Pythagora](https://www.pythagora.ai) - VS Code extension with natural language app development, multi-agent architecture, and autonomous deployment capabilities.
- [Quack AI](https://www.quack-ai.com/) - VS Code extension for coding guidelines.
- [Roo Code](https://github.com/RooVetGit/Roo-Code) - VS Code extension with natural language interaction, multi-provider support, and specialized coding modes.
- [Rubberduck](https://github.com/rubberduck-ai/rubberduck-vscode) - Open source chat assistant for VS Code.
- [Tabby](https://tabbyml.github.io/tabby/) - Open source, self-hosted code completion assistant.
- [Traycer](https://traycer.ai) - VS Code extension for intelligent code change management with real-time analysis and automated reviews.
- [CodeMate](https://www.codemate.ai/) - VS Code extension for debugging and optimization.
- [CodeComplete](https://codecomplete.ai/) - Self-hosted enterprise completion assistant.
- [JetBrains AI](https://www.jetbrains.com/ai/) - AI assistant for all JetBrains IDEs.
- [Sourcery](https://sourcery.ai/) - AI assistant and linter for multiple editors.
- [Swimm](https://swimm.io) - Assistant for code understanding and documentation.
- [Supermaven](https://supermaven.com/) - VS Code extension with large context window.
- [Android Studio Bot](https://developer.android.com/studio/preview/studio-bot) - AI assistant for Android Studio.
- [IBM watsonx Code Assistant for Z](https://www.ibm.com/products/watsonx-code-assistant-z) - AI tool for mainframe application modernization.
- [Junie](https://www.jetbrains.com/junie/) - JetBrains' AI coding agent for Python, Kotlin, and Java, featuring adaptive learning and deep IDE integration.
- [Cline](https://github.com/cline/cline) - VS Code extension with real-time debugging, browser control, and multi-model AI support.

## Code Generation & Analysis

### Code Review Tools
- [Codium.ai](https://www.codium.ai/) - Automated unit test generation and AI-driven code assistance.
- [Codiga](https://www.codiga.io/) - Customizable static code analysis tool.
- [CodeRabbit](https://coderabbit.ai/) - AI-powered code review platform.
- [Snyk](https://snyk.io/) - Security platform for building secure applications.
- [Mutahunter](https://mutahunter.ai) - Open-source, AI-driven software testing tool.

### Pull Request Automation
- [Sweep](https://github.com/sweepai/sweep) - GitHub integration for AI-driven PR generation.
- [BitBuilder](https://www.bitbuilder.ai/) - GitHub integration for PR generation from issues.
- [Codegen](https://www.codegen.com/) - GPT-4 based PR agent for enterprise codebases.
- [Code Review GPT](https://github.com/mattzcarey/code-review-gpt) - Open source tool for PR reviews.
- [Codeium PR Agent](https://github.com/Codium-ai/pr-agent) - Open source tool for automated code reviews.
- [Nova](https://www.trynova.ai/) - CI bot for PR actions.
- [CodeRabbit](https://coderabbit.ai/) - Customizable CI for PR enhancements.
- [SwePT](https://github.com/keerthanpg/SwePT) - Open source PR generator.
- [Duckie](https://duckie.ai/) - Web-based chat assistant for GitHub repositories.
- [PR Explainer Bot](https://pr-explainer-bot.web.app/) - GitHub integration for PR explanations.
- [Goast](https://goast.ai/) - Tool for error log analysis and fix suggestions.
- [Corgea](https://corgea.com/) - GitHub integration for vulnerability detection and fixing.
- [vx.dev](https://github.com/Yuyz0112/vx.dev) - GitHub integration for UI generation.
- [Pixee](https://pixee.ai) - AI bot for code quality and security improvements.
- [CodeAnt AI](https://www.codeant.ai/) - Automated PR creation for code issue fixes.
- [What The Diff](https://whatthediff.ai/) - AI-powered PR diff reviewer.
- [Trag](https://usetrag.com/) - AI-powered code reviews with customizable patterns.

### Testing Tools
- [OctoMind](https://octomind.dev) - AI-powered end-to-end test generation and maintenance.
- [Traceloop](https://traceloop.com/) - AI-enhanced system reliability tool.
- [Carbonate](https://carbonate.dev/) - Natural language end-to-end testing tool.
- [Meticulous.ai](https://www.meticulous.ai/) - Automated end-to-end test generation and maintenance.
- [DiffBlue](https://www.diffblue.com/) - Automated Java unit test generator.
- [CodiumAI](https://www.codium.ai/) - Non-trivial test generation for major languages.
- [DeepUnit](https://www.deepunit.ai/) - AI-powered test case and file generation.
- [MutahunterAI](https://github.com/codeintegrity-ai/mutahunter) - Open-source tool for vulnerability detection and test generation.
- [KushoAI](https://kusho.ai/) - AI agent for comprehensive API testing.

### Documentation Generation
- [Stenography.dev](https://stenography.dev/) - AI-powered code documentation tool.
- [Mintlify](https://mintlify.com/) - Modern documentation platform with AI assistance.
- [AI Kernel Explorer](https://github.com/mathiscode/ai-kernel-explorer) - Tool for understanding Linux kernel code.
- [Code to Flow](https://codetoflow.com) - Visualize and analyze code with flowcharts.
- [Trelent](https://trelent.net/) - VS Code extension for docstring generation.
- [Docify](https://docify.ai4code.io/) - VS Code extension for docstring generation.
- [Mintlify Writer](https://writer.mintlify.com/) - VS Code extension for docstring generation.
- [DiagramGPT](https://www.eraser.io/diagramgpt) - AI-based diagram generator from various inputs.
- [DocuWriter.ai](https://www.docuwriter.ai/) - AI-powered code and API documentation generator.
- [README-AI](https://github.com/eli64s/readme-ai) - Automated README.md file generator.
- [Supacodes](https://www.supacodes.com) - AI tool for GitHub code documentation.
- [CodexAtlas](https://codedocumentation.app/) - Automated code and API documentation tool.

## Application Development

### App Generators
- [Pico](https://picoapps.xyz) - End-to-end micro app generator with instant deployment.
- [Literally anything](https://literallyanything.io) - HTML and JavaScript web app generator.
- [GPT Web App Generator](https://magic-app-generator.wasp-lang.dev/) - Full-stack app generator.
- [Make Real](https://makereal.tldraw.com/) - Online canvas for HTML/JavaScript app generation.
- [Marblism](https://marblism.com) - SaaS boilerplate generator.
- [Glowbom](https://glowbom.com/) - Multi-platform app generator.
- [Mage](https://usemage.ai/) - Full-stack web app generator.
- [Magic](https://magic.dev/) - Company developing AI coding assistant and foundation model.
- [Poolside](https://poolside.ai/) - Company building code generation models.

### UI/UX Tools
- [v0](https://v0.dev/) - Browser-based UI component creator.
- [Rendition Create](https://www.renditioncreate.com/) - Browser-based UI component creator.
- [Rapidpages](https://www.rapidpages.io/) - Open source UI generator.
- [Magic Patterns](https://www.magicpatterns.com/) - Comprehensive UI prototyping tool.
- [Clone UI](https://clone-ui.design/) - Tailwind CSS UI component generator.
- [Tempo](https://www.tempolabs.ai/) - WYSIWYG editor for React interfaces.
- [Kombai](https://kombai.com/) - AI tool for Figma to frontend code conversion.
- [CodeParrot](https://www.codeparrot.ai/) - VS Code plugin for Figma to frontend code generation.
- [Galileo AI](https://www.usegalileo.ai/) - Text-to-UI platform (waitlisted).
- [Uizard](https://uizard.io/) - Multi-screen mockup generator and editor.
- [Frontly](https://fronty.com/) - Image to HTML/CSS converter.
- [BoringUi](https://www.boringui.xyz/) - JSON-based UI generator with HTML and Tailwind CSS output.
- [Visual Copilot](https://www.builder.io/m/design-to-code) - Figma plugin for multi-framework code generation.
- [Codejet](https://www.codejet.ai/) - Figma to code conversion platform.

### Database Tools
- [AI2SQL](https://www.ai2sql.io/) - AI-powered SQL query builder.
- [TEXT2SQL.AI](https://www.text2sql.ai/) - AI tool for SQL query translation and explanation.
- [SQLAI.ai](https://www.sqlai.ai/) - AI for SQL query generation and optimization.
- [WhoDB](https://github.com/clidey/whodb) - AI-powered data explorer for various databases.

## Developer Productivity

### Git Tools
- [GitBrain](https://gitbrain.dev/) - Git client with AI-powered workflow simplification.
- [GitButler](https://gitbutler.com/) - Git client for simultaneous branch management.
- [ChatWithGit](https://gitsearch.sdan.io/) - ChatGPT plugin for GitHub search.

### Command Line Tools
- [talk-codebase](https://github.com/rsaryev/talk-codebase) - CLI chatbot with repository context.
- [Warp](https://www.warp.dev/) - Modern terminal with AI assistance.
- [AskCommand](https://www.askcommand.cppexpert.online/) - Web tool for Unix command generation.
- [Butterfish](https://butterfi.sh) - CLI tool embedding ChatGPT in your shell.
- [Shell Whiz](https://github.com/beimzhan/shell-whiz) - Configurable CLI assistant for shell commands.
- [GitFluence](https://www.gitfluence.com/) - Web-based Git command generator.
- [Codebuff](https://www.codebuff.com/) - Terminal-based coding assistant using natural language to modify codebases across 11 languages.

### Search Tools
- [Bloop](https://bloop.ai/) - Natural language search for repositories.
- [Greptile](https://greptile.com/) - Natural language search for repositories.
- [Buildt](https://www.buildt.ai/) - Natural language search for repositories (waitlisted).
- [SeaGOAT](https://kantord.github.io/SeaGOAT/latest/) - Local semantic codebase search tool.

### Productivity Tools
- [Pieces for Developers](https://pieces.app) - AI-enabled desktop app for code snippet management with offline processing, multi-IDE integration, and built-in AI copilot.

## AI Agents & Platforms

### Development Agents
- [Mentat](https://www.mentat.codes/) - CLI assistant for repository changes.
- [Micro Agent](https://github.com/micro-ai/micro-agent) - Open-source tool for AI-driven code generation.
- [Replit Agent](https://replit.com/ai) - Multi-agent system for building applications through natural language with automated environment setup and deployment.
- [Second.dev](https://www.second.dev/) - Platform for adding features to full-stack apps.
- [Smol Developer](https://github.com/smol-ai/developer) - CLI agent for repository generation.
- [Aider](https://github.com/paul-gauthier/aider) - Open-source AI pair programming tool.
- [Blinky](https://github.com/seahyinghang8/blinky) - Debugging agent for VS Code.
- [GPT Engineer](https://github.com/AntonOsika/gpt-engineer) - CLI agent for repository generation with Q&A.
- [GPT Migrate](https://github.com/0xpayne/gpt-migrate) - CLI agent for full-stack application conversion.
- [Grit](https://app.grit.io) - GitHub-integrated agent for development tasks.
- [DemoGPT](https://github.com/melih-unsal/DemoGPT) - Auto Gen-AI App Generator using Llama 2.
- [DevOpsGPT](https://github.com/kuafuai/DevOpsGPT) - AI-Driven Software Development Automation Solution.
- [Factory](https://www.factory.ai/) - Agents for code generation (waitlisted).
- [sudocode](https://sudocode.ai/) - Web-based chat assistant for project generation.
- [CodeFlash AI](https://www.codeflash.ai/) - CLI and CI tool for Python code optimization.
- [Fine](https://fine.dev/?ref=awesome) - AI Dev Environment for automating various tasks.

### Agent Platforms
- [Composio](https://composio.dev/) - Open source toolset for AI Agents & LLMs.
- [E2B](https://www.e2b.dev/) - Open source cloud platform for LLM-based agents.
- [Morph Rift](https://github.com/morph-labs/rift) - VS Code extension for merging AI-generated code.
- [SuperAGI](https://superagi.com/) - Open source platform for LLM-based agents.
- [MetaGPT](https://www.deepwisdom.ai/) - Open-source multi-agent framework for GPT models.

### OpenAI Plugins
- [ChatWithGit](https://gitsearch.sdan.io/) - ChatGPT plugin for GitHub search.
- [Code ChatGPT Plugin](https://github.com/kesor/chatgpt-code-plugin) - ChatGPT plugin for file context.

---

This list is just the beginning. Feel free to contribute by adding more AI-powered development tools that you find useful!